Job Description & How to Apply Below
* Assist the BSA Officer with monitoring the Bank's BSA program and ensuring adherence to BSA, Anti-Money Laundering (AML), and Customer Identification Program (CIP), and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C) policies
* Complete a review of new customer for CIP requirements; communicate to retail and lending department of any missing or incomplete requirements for CIP compliance
* Review of Customer Due Diligence (CDD) questionnaires for completion and appropriateness of responses; communicate updates needed to retail department
* Assist with Currency Transaction Reporting
* Review and certify OFAC reports and alerts
* Communicate with the retail department to ensure accurate and timely report filing and address any BSA deficiencies
